THE SANCTUARY
Our retreat takes place at the beautiful Blue Green Sanctuary, a private five-acre oasis nestled in the lush Byron Bay hinterland. Once an orchid farm, the lush property is surrounded by paddocks and tropical plantations, offering the perfect backdrop for yoga, meditation and other restorative practices.
Just 15 minutes from Byron Bay’s beaches and buzz, and 5 minutes from the charming village of Bangalow, Blue Green is the ideal blend of peaceful escape and easy access.

Vinyasa yoga blends strength with softness, breath-led movement, mindfulness and and a focus on safe, intelligent alignment.
Yoga practices and workshops will be held in a serene, covered shala overlooking the tranquil retreat grounds.
Sessions can be modified for all levels – from curious beginners to seasoned yoga practitioners. A general level of fitness is recommended.
Retreats also give us the gift of time – to explore more than just asana, including meditation, breathwork, mantra, guided relaxation (yoga nidra) and yogic philosophy.
Together, we’ll deepen your understanding of yoga through Classical Yoga & Patanjali’s 8 Limbs of Yoga, a timeless framework for living with more integrity, abundance, peace & joy.
